Output 528d1919479460a21ba8f5d809b0a103559142f27f0c442e1c03ffb7f6df14e5:1

value
18298008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 310dacc190f72b9bf6b3fc1620f53705bb7ce1fa OP_EQUAL
address
36APR61ZowbuWiaT5cK4PfyDHT3mBuy3MZ
transaction
528d1919479460a21ba8f5d809b0a103559142f27f0c442e1c03ffb7f6df14e5
spent
true